Kuga warning light and smoke

Hey, I'm having trouble with my 2010 Ford Kuga, gasoline engine. The warning light is on, and it's smoking a lot when I accelerate. It's got about 200874 kilometers on it. I'm thinking it might be the exhaust back pressure sensor. Anyone seen this before? How did you figure it out?
